By Aaauger I was thrilled to find this book. There's something special about an Italian cookie bakery with the variety of designs and flavors. I tried four recipes. Two were good but were similar to recipes I already had: Coconut Macaroons and Anise cookies. The other two were failures: the Florentines were so thin that they separated from the almonds and the Sesame cookies were inedibly bitter. Many of the recipes use the same base ingredients which makes for easy preparation but somewhat redundant taste. I wished for the more elaborate cookies. My biggest issue was the lack of photos for visual guidance. Also appearance is a huge part of Italian cookies. I'm sure that the absence of photos kept the cost of printing down but it was a false economy. I will try more recipes in this book but will also look for others with more instruction.

By M. K. Foley Well written, nice selection of traditional Italian cookies, just what I was looking for. So far, I've made the biscotti and the sesame cookies and both were delicious.
My only complaint is that the ingredients list is printed in a tiny font that is very hard to read and makes it easy to make a mistake on measuring - so read the measurements carefully. If not for that I'd have given it 5 stars.
